HDMI Port

HDMI (High-Definition Multimedia Interface) is an
uncompressed all-digital audio/video interface between
any audio/video source, such as a set-top box, DVD player,
and A/V receiver and an audio and/or video monitor, such
as a digital television (DTV). Supports standard, enhanced,
or high-definition video, plus multi-channel digital audio
on a single cable. It transmits all ATSC HDTV standards and
supports 8-channel digital audio, with bandwidth to spare
to accommodate future enhancements or requirements.

Antenna Input (on selected models)

The antenna input is for TV frequency signal and allows
for use with the provided digital TV antenna or input from
subscription television services. The provided antenna can
receive digital TV.

Flash Memory Slot

Normally an external memory card reader must be
purchased separately in order to use memory cards from
devices such as digital cameras, MP3 players, mobile
phones, and PDAs. This Notebook PC has a built-in
high-speed memory card reader that can conveniently read
from and write to many flash memory cards.

Display (Monitor) Output

The 15-pin D-sub monitor port supports a standard
VGA-compatible device such as a monitor or projector to
allow viewing on a larger external display.
